| Directions: |
| 1. |
Cut three sheets of tissue paper (red, yellow and orange) into approximately 1" x 1" squares. Crumple the tissue paper. |
| 2. |
Direct students to dip the crumpled tissue paper into glue and stick it onto the bowls. Set aside to dry. |
| 3. |
Reduce or enlarge the sun template so that the suns circle is the same size as the rim of the bowl. |
| 4. |
Staple three sheets of tissue paper (red, yellow and orange) together. Trace the sun template onto the layers of tissue paper, then cut out the shape you just traced. |
| 5. |
Put glue on the rim of one bowl and place it facedown on the tissue paper. Let it set for a few minutes. Repeat the process on the other bowl. |
| 6. |
Once the bowls have completely dried, staple them together. Punch a hole at the top, and display with yarn. |
